Resident Evil 3 Remake Officially Announced by Capcom

4.6
Resident Evil 3 is indeed real and it's set to launch in April.
Following its leaking on the PlayStation Store last week, Capcom today formally announced the remake of Resident Evil 3 during PlayStation’s State of Play live stream.

Resident Evil 3 was revealed via a new trailer during the stream which showed off the game’s iconic characters of Jill Valentine and Carlos Oliveira once again in the shattered remains of Raccoon City. We also get a very brief look at Nemesis, the game’s infamous antagonist, at the very end of the trailer, and he looks like he’s going to be as horrifying as ever. The game’s presentation and look are also very reminiscent of Capcom’s remake of Resident Evil 2, which shouldn’t be a surprise given that it only launched back in January of this year. There are also a handful of first-person sequences seen throughout the trailer, but as of this writing, it’s uncertain if the game will contain any aspects that take place from this point of view.

Perhaps the best news of all with this Resident Evil 3 announcement is that the game is releasing very, very soon. Capcom has announced that Resident Evil 3 will be launching on PS4, Xbox One, and PC on April 3, 2020. In addition, the multiplayer game Project Resistance which also takes place in the Resident Evil universe will be coming bundled with RE3 for free. While I’m sure many would have bought Resident Evil 3 on its own, it’s cool to see this multiplayer experience bundled in with the game.
